Handover: Marisol to Devin, GateCount service at Ravelin Stadium. The turnstile counter aggregates pulses from 42 lanes via the Fenwick relay boxes; debounce logic lives in the collector, not the firmware. Audit logging is enabled on every write path, and no credentials are stored on the edge units. The current production configuration values are listed below.

config for kawif-hahig:
zorix:
  log_level: error
  metrics_host: metrics.zorix.lumiclabs.internal
  pool_size: 16

Leadership Review Briefing — Westvale Region

Quick heads-up before Thursday's session: Westvale sales came in about 6% under plan, mostly due to slow uptake of the Corvana line in the Harlen Bay territory. Margins held up better than expected, so it's not all gloom. Priya from regional ops will walk through the recovery plan, and finance should be ready to field questions on the Q3 reforecast. One more thing before you dive into the deck — keep the following strictly within this group.

management briefing: Project Ulavan slips by two quarters because of the staffing delay.

**Notes — password reset revamp (Harborlight portal)**

- Old email-link flow retired end of month.
- New flow: short-lived code, three attempts, then lockout with support override.
- Support: do NOT reset codes manually; use the override console only.
- Known issue: codes delayed on the Velmora mail relay, fix in progress.
- Escalation path unchanged; tag tickets with the revamp label.
- FAQ draft circulating this week.

All escalations and sign-offs route through the owner named below.

approver of yawig-yajef = Briius Jorix